李伯成《微型计算机原理及应用》课后习题答案Word下载.docx
- 文档编号:13094303
- 上传时间:2022-10-04
- 格式:DOCX
- 页数:24
- 大小:50.92KB
李伯成《微型计算机原理及应用》课后习题答案Word下载.docx
《李伯成《微型计算机原理及应用》课后习题答案Word下载.docx》由会员分享,可在线阅读,更多相关《李伯成《微型计算机原理及应用》课后习题答案Word下载.docx(24页珍藏版)》请在冰豆网上搜索。
1*26+1*25+0*24+1*23+1*22+0*21+1*20
=64D+32D+0D+8D+4D+0D+1D=109D
1.2将下列二进制小数转换成十进制数:
(1)X=0.00111B=
0*2-1+0*2-2+1*2-3+1*2-4+1*2-5=
0D+0D+0.125D+0.0625D+0.03125D=0.21875D
(2)X=0.11011B=
1*2-1+1*2-2+0*2-3+1*2-4+1*2-5=
0.5D+0.25D+0D+0.0625D+0.03125D=0.84375D
(3) X=0.101101B=
1*2-1+0*2-2+1*2-3+1*2-4+0*2-5+1*2-6=
0.5D+0D+0.125D+0.0625D+0D+0.015625D=0.703125D
1.3 将下列十进制整数转换成二进制数:
1.4将下列十进制小数转换成二进制数:
(1)X=0.75D=0.11B
(2)X=0.102D=0.0001101B
1.5将下列十进制数转换成二进制数
(1)100.25D=01100100.01H
(2)680.75D=001010101000.11B
1.6将下列二进制数转换成十进制数
(1)X=1001101.1011B=77.6875D
(2)X=111010.00101B=58.15625D
1.7将下列二进制数转换成八进制数
101’011’101B=535Q
1’101’111’010’010B=15722Q
(3)X=110B=6Q
1.8将下列八进制数转换成二进制数:
(1)X=760Q=111'
110'
000B
(2)X=32415Q=11'
010'
100'
001'
101B
1.9将下列二进制数转换成十六进制数:
X=101010111101101B=55EDH
1.10将下列十六进制数转换成二进制数:
X=ABCH=101010111100B
X=3A6F.FFH=0011101001101111.11111111B
X=F1C3.4B=1111000111000011.01001011B
1.11将下列二进制数转换成BCD码:
(1)X=1011011.101B=1'
011'
011.101B=91.625d=10010001.0110BCD
(2)X=1010110.001B=1’010’110.001=126.1BCD
1.12将下列十进制数转换成BCD码:
(1)X=1024D=0001000000100100BCD
(2)X=632=011000110010BCD
(3)X=103=000100000011BCD
1.13写出下列字符的ASCII码:
A41H65D01000001B
939H47D
*2AH42D
=3DH45D
!
21H33D
1.14若加上偶校验码,下列字符的ASCII码是什么?
字符原码加上偶校验码之后
B42H,01000010B 42H,01000010B
434H,00110100BB4H,10110100B
737H,00110111BB7H,10110111B
=3DH,00111101BBDH,10111101B
!
21H,00100001B21H,00100001B
?
3FH00111111B3FH,00111111B
1.15加上奇校验,上面的结果如何?
字符原码加上奇校验码之后
B42H,01000010B C2H,11000010B
434H,00110100B34H,00110100B
737H,00110111B37H,00110111B
=3DH,00111101B3DH,00111101B
21H,00100001BA1H,10100001B
3FH00111111BBFH,10111111B
1.16计算下式:
BCD=(42H/2+ABH-D9H)*0.21BCD=
=F3H*0.21BCD=(-DH)*0.21BCD=-2.73D
(2)3CH–[(84D)/(16Q)+’8’/8D]=60D-[84D/14D+(56/8)]=60D-[13]D=
=47D
1.17对下列十进制数,用八位二进制数写出其原码、反码和补码:
(正数的反码与原码相同,负数的反码除符号位之外其余各位按位取反。
正数的补码与原码相同;
负数的补码除符号位以外,其余各位按位取反之后再加一。
)
数据原码反码补码
+99011000110110001101100011
-99111000111001110010011101
+12701111111 0111111101111111
-127111111111000000010000001
+0000000000000000000000000
-0100000001111111100000000
1.188位二进制数原码可表示数的范围是+127~-128;
8位二进制数补码可表示的数的范围是+127~-127;
8位二进制数反码可表示的数的范围是:
+127~-128;
1.1916位二进制数的原码、补码、反码可表示的数的范围是多少?
+32767~-32768、+32767~-32768、+32767~-32768;
1.20至少写出3种用二进制编码状态表示十进制数字的编码方式。
8421码、5421码2421码余3码十进制数
0000000000000011 0
0001000100010100 1
0010 001010000101 2
0011 001110010110 3
0100 010010100111 4
0101 100010111000 5
0110 100111001001 6
01111010110110107
10001011111010118
10011100111111009
李伯成《微机原理》习题第二章
④洪志全等编《现代计算机接口技术》
电子工业出版社2002年4月
⑤仇玉章主编《32位微型计算机原理与接口技术》
清华大学出版社2000年9月
2.18086CPU的RESET引脚的功能是什么?
答:
RESET引脚称为复位引脚,输入、三态、高电平有效;
RESET引脚将使CPU立即结束当前操作,处理器要求RESET信号至少要保持4个时钟周期的高电平,才能结束它正在进行的操作。
CPU复位以后,除了代码段寄存器CS的值为FFFFH外,其余所有寄存器的值均为零,指令队列为空。
当RESET回到低电平时,CPU开始执行“热启动”程序,由于此时CS的值为FFFFH,IP的值为0000H,所以CPU复位以后执行的第一条指令的物理地址为FFFF0H,该单元通常放置一条段间直接转移指令JMPSS:
OO,SS:
OO即为系统程序的实际起始地址。
2.2在8086CPU工作在最小模式时,
(1)当CPU访问存储器时,要利用哪些信号?
当CPU访问存储器时,要利用AD0~AD15、WR*、RD*、IO/M*以及A16~A19;
(2)当CPU访问外设接口时,要利用哪些信号?
当CPU访问外设接口时,同样要利用AD0---AD15、WR*、RD*以及IO/M*,但不使用高端地址线A16---A19;
(3)当HOLD有效并得到响应时,CPU哪些引脚置高阻?
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 微型计算机原理及应用 李伯成 微型计算机 原理 应用 课后 习题 答案